搭建APP下載鏡像服務(wù)器的推薦配置
為了確保用戶能夠順暢地下載APP的鏡像,服務(wù)器需要具備一定的硬件和軟件配置,以下是推薦的服務(wù)器配置:
硬件配置
1. 處理器(CPU)
至少四核,建議使用高性能的Intel Xeon或AMD EPYC系列處理器。
2. 內(nèi)存(RAM)
至少32GB,根據(jù)實際需求可適當(dāng)增加。
3. 存儲(Storage)
SSD硬盤,容量至少1TB,根據(jù)實際需求可適當(dāng)增加。
建議采用RAID技術(shù)提高數(shù)據(jù)安全性。
4. 網(wǎng)絡(luò)帶寬
至少1Gbps的公網(wǎng)帶寬,確保用戶下載速度。
軟件配置
1. 操作系統(tǒng)(OS)
推薦使用Linux發(fā)行版,如Ubuntu、CentOS等。
2. Web服務(wù)器
Nginx或Apache,用于處理HTTP請求。
3. 數(shù)據(jù)庫(DB)
MySQL或PostgreSQL,用于存儲和管理APP信息。
4. 編程語言及框架
根據(jù)實際開發(fā)語言選擇,如Python、Java、Node.js等。
安全配置
1. 防火墻
配置合適的防火墻規(guī)則,限制不必要的端口訪問。
2. SSL證書
為服務(wù)器配置SSL證書,確保數(shù)據(jù)傳輸安全。
3. 定期備份
定期對服務(wù)器數(shù)據(jù)進(jìn)行備份,防止數(shù)據(jù)丟失。
監(jiān)控與維護(hù)
1. 日志分析
定期查看服務(wù)器日志,分析異常情況。
2. 性能監(jiān)控
使用性能監(jiān)控工具,如Nagios、Zabbix等,實時監(jiān)控服務(wù)器狀態(tài)。
3. 系統(tǒng)更新
定期更新操作系統(tǒng)和軟件,修復(fù)已知漏洞。